Uncovering Hidden Insights
To get a holistic view of the customer experience, you must gather customer feedback at every point on the customer’s end-to-end journey.
Once you’ve gathered your data, a robust survey and feedback management system will let you test that data and compare it to different views. it lets you explore your data in different ways and hidden insights or discover trends you wouldn’t otherwise detect.
The insights uncovered from customer data translate into opportunities and innovation to:
- Improve your products and services: Incorporate customer feedback to prioritize new product launches, create new services and identify new customer needs.
- Increase your customer engagement: Customer experience data can help you improve your messaging, connect with customers on a more personal level and help you discover the right cadence for communication.
- Uncover opportunities and gaps in the market: Your sales team will appreciate the ability to score leads, the understanding of when and how customers want to be followed up with, and the knowledge of what to buy signals to listen for.
- Improve customer service: Data-driven customer insights help your customer service team solve problems before they cause customer attrition.
